The correlation between historical prices or returns on LRN and PING is a relative statistical measure of the degree to which these equity instruments tend to move together. The correlation coefficient measures the extent to which returns on PING are associated (or correlated) with LRN. Values of the correlation coefficient range from -1 to +1, where. The correlation of zero (0) is possible when the price movement of LRN has no effect on the direction of PING i.e., PING and LRN go up and down completely randomly.

Pair Trading with PING and LRN

The main advantage of trading using opposite PING and LRN posit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if PING position performs unexpectedly, LRN can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market. For example, if an entire industry or sector drops because of unexpected headlines, the short position in LRN will offset losses from the drop in LRN's long position.
The idea behind PING and LRN pairs trading is to make the combined position market-neutral, meaning the overall market's direction will not affect its win or loss (or potential downside or upside). This can be achieved by designing a pairs trade with two highly correlated stocks or equities that operate in a similar space or sector, making it possible to obtain profits through simple and relatively low-risk investment.
